Is 424 935 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 424 935 is about 651.870.

Thus, the square root of 424 935 is not an integer, and therefore 424 935 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 424 935?

The square of a number (here 424 935) is the result of the product of this number (424 935) by itself (i.e., 424 935 × 424 935); the square of 424 935 is sometimes called "raising 424 935 to the power 2", or "424 935 squared".

The square of 424 935 is 180 569 754 225 because 424 935 × 424 935 = 424 9352 = 180 569 754 225.

As a consequence, 424 935 is the square root of 180 569 754 225.
